    For general purpose, Henkle or Trident sets will do nicely. A Set should consist of a 14″ slicer, 8″ or 10″ chef knife, a boning knife and a paring knife plus the steel. It will set you back about US$250.
    For other specialty knife, look for the Japanese producers.
